Harper Lee's famous novel "To Kill A Mockingbird" revolves around the theme of racism and the racist attitude of the people of Maycomb, Alabama. The Finches, through which the writer reveals the plot and story are also part of this town but were different in their viewpoint and even approach.
The character of Mrs. Dubose is an ill tempered woman who lived near the Finches and would always find one thing or another to grumble about. In chapter 11, she is seen exclaiming <em>"What’s this world coming to when a Finch goes against his raising?</em>" By this, she meant to say that she is appalled to find that Atticus is defending the black man Tom Robinson for the ra pe case. She represents the true white people, racist against the blacks and would even criticize whoever defends the blacks. This is not the way in the South, where the whites look out for their own kind. What Atticus is doing is against that very idea, and instead he's fighting for the black man Tom.
